Сайт о телевидении

Сайт о телевидении

» » Что значит домен не делегирован. Что такое делегирование домена

Что значит домен не делегирован. Что такое делегирование домена

В этой статье я покажу, как делегировать домен, расскажу, что это значит, а также вы узнаете, что такое DNS. Вообще, новичкам это может показаться сложным, однако это придётся сделать для того, чтобы создать сайт. Делать это нужно всего один раз для каждого нового сайта. Потребуется также и при переносе с одного хостинга на другой или с локального сервера на реальный хостинг. В общем, вещь нужная и знать обязательно, хоть и трудно понять.

Для того чтобы рассказать, как делегировать домен, мне придётся начать издалека – с DNS.

DNS – это система доменных имён, в которой содержатся данные о том, какой IP у домена сайта, а следовательно, в какому хостингу он относится. Отсюда становится понятно – что если DNS настроена неправильно, то сайт работать не будет.

Как делегировать домен на хостинг

Итак, теперь переходим непосредственно к вопросу о том, как делегировать домен. Как вы должны были уже догадаться сами, под делегированием понимается присвоение доменному имени IP адреса сервера хостинга.

Делегирование домена, говоря простыми словами – это направление домена на хостинг. Данный процесс показывает, на каком хостинге находится тот или иной домен и откуда нужно закачивать файлы для отображения их в браузере посетителя.

Направление домена происходит с помощью назначения ему NS серверов хостинга (под NS кроется и IP, но он имеет совершенно иной вид). Перед тем, как делегировать домен, вам следует получить NS своего хостинга. Делается это в персональном кабинете хостинг-аккаунта. Покажу на скриншоте, как это выглядит на хостинге, на котором находится раньше находился мой сайт (). Если у вас другой хостинг, то у вас должно быть что-то похожее, но суть одинакова. NS бывает несколько – обычно 4 штуки.


Получаем NS от хостинга

Мои NS выглядят так:

ns1.hostinger.ru

ns2.hostinger.ru

ns3.hostinger.ru

ns4.hostinger.ru

Теперь переходим в персональный кабинет регистратора своего домена и записываем там полученный NS. Опять же, как делегировать домен я покажу на примере своего регистратора (). Если у вас другой, то кое-что будет отличаться, но суть одна и та же.


Записываем NS в кабинете регистратора домена

Прописывание NS от хостинга в панели управления домена – это и есть направление домена на хостинг. Теперь вы знаете, как делегировать домен, но не знаете ещё кое-чего.

Обновление DNS

Отдельная история – это обновление DNS. Понятно, что каждый день регистрируется множество доменных имён, кроме того, многие переезжают с одного хостинга на другой (с одного NS на другой). Поэтому система DNS должна постоянно обновляться, чтобы оставаться актуальной.

Обновление DNS происходит у каждого интернет-провайдера по-своему и не зависит ни от кого, кроме них самих. То есть, каждый интернет провайдер обновляет в своём собственном кэше информацию о привязанности того или иного доменного имени к какому-то хостингу. Делают это провайдеры редко – у некоторых может доходить до 1 раза каждые 72 часа.

Поэтому, если вы делегировали домен и прописали NS хостинга, сайт будет работать полноценно только через 72 часа. В течение этого времени он может в некоторых регионах уже работать, а в других ещё нет. Ругаться с поддержкой хостера или регистратора нет смысла. Также интернет-провайдер вам ничего не поможет. В этом случае нужно просто подождать, пока заданные вами NS распространятся по всему миру.

Как посмотреть сайт, если делегирование домена ещё не завершилось

Если DNS у вашего провайдера ещё не обновились, а вам необходимо срочно начать работать на своём новом сайте, то можно сделать следующее. Переходим на компьютере в папку C:\Windows\System32\drivers\etc (где «С» — это диск, на котором установлено операционная система) и открываем файл hosts. Он без расширения, открыть его можно с помощью любого текстового редактора, например, блокнота. В файле hosts записываем следующие данные.

Тот человек, который хоть раз в самостоятельном порядке занимался делегированием домена (доменного имени) согласится, что тот , который был приобретен у одного , лучше будет размещать на сервере другого регистратора, который предоставляет услуги хостинга. С первого взгляда, кажется, что это весьма простая операция, которая не требует специальных знаний, но тот человек, который занимается проведением данной процедуры впервые, становится в ступор.

Для чего необходимо проводить процедуру делегирования домена

Для того чтобы дать ответ на столь важный вопрос, необходимо сначала четко понимать, что доменом является всего лишь персональный адрес вашего сайта, на который можно перейти с любого места на планете, которое имеет подключение к глобальной сети. Но для того чтобы домен начал полноценно работать его необходимо разместить на и осуществить его привязку к серверам данного хостинга, другими словами можно сказать, что производится процедура DNS подключения.

Для того что бы предоставить сайту максимально безопасную работу ему необходимо наличие двух DNSсерверов. Если один сервер перестанет полноценно работать, то данную задачу возьмет на себя второй DNS сервер. Следует понимать, что доступность вашего сайта является весьма важным показателем, который будет непосредственно влиять на размер вашей клиентской базы. Как выдумаете, вернется ли один и тот же посетитель к вам на сайт, если однажды ваш проект на протяжении даже не столь длительного времени был недоступным? А его недоступность может быть по причине отключения электроэнергии или негативных последствий стихийного бедствия, ситуации бывают разными, а вот итог будет одинаков.

Как осуществляется делегирование домена

Рассмотрим решение проблемы на конкретном примере. Доменное имя было приобретено у регистратора «1», а привязать его к хостингу необходимо регистратора «2». Вся суть проведения данного процесса заключается в том, что в конце процесса оформления доменного имени у регистратора «1» у вас потребуют предоставить адрес двух DNS серверов от регистратора «2», делается это для того, чтобы предоставить максимально надежную и стабильную работу вашего интернет — проекта. Из этого следует сделать вывод, что услуга хостинга от регистратора «2» должна быть заказана заблаговременно.

После того, как процесс регистрации доменного имени будет завершен, появится две и более ячейки, в которых необходимо будет разместить уже имеющиеся адреса DNS сервера для делегирования домена. Естественно, что эти ячейки можно оставить и пустыми, а заполнить их только после того, как будет принято решение относительно выбора хостера. Но пример будет рассмотрен в случае с заполнением двух ячеек.

К примеру, у вас имеется хостинг провайдер RU center, два сервера которого находятся в Амстердаме и в Москве, и для проведения процедуры делегирования необходимо прописать данные сервера. DNS 1: ns4.nic.ru (первая ячейка) и DNS 2: ns5.nic.ru (вторая ячейка). Вы можете прописать и третий адрес, к примеру, ns6.nic.ru , но данная процедура не является обязательной. Вместо DNS можно прописать и IP адрес, но данная ситуация никак не облегчает общий процесс. Но если вам так будет удобнее, то можете узнать IP адреса у службы поддержки регистратора, который предоставляет вам хостинг.

Для того чтобы проводить процедуру делегирования домена больше ничего не потребуется. После того как обновится информация относительно ситуации в доменных зонах, делегированный домен будет доступен для своего использования на указанном вами хостинге, и вы можете начать заполнять свой сайт .

Делегирование домена — процесс передачи контроля за частью доменной зоны другой ответственной стороне. Несмотря на то что это весьма сложно звучит, само делегирование домена заключается в указании для него DNS-серверов. Это операция доступна любому человеку с начальным уровнем знаний интернет-пользователя. Технически же, чтобы делегировать домен, нужно указать в его зоне ресурсную запись (чаще несколько записей) типа NS .

Согласно Правилам регистрации доменных имен в доменах.RU и.РФ, заявка на делегирование выполняется только при условии, что регистратор проверил возможность связи с администратором по хранящемуся в Реестре номеру телефона с функцией приема коротких текстовых сообщений (sms).

В некоторых зонах (например .ru , .su и .рф ) домены могут быть сняты с делегирования, несмотря на то что для них указаны DNS-серверы. Фактически такой домен не будет доступен, контроль над его зоной не будет передан никаким name-серверам, но whois-сервер по-прежнему будет сообщать, что для домена прописаны некие DNS-серверы. При этом whois-сервер обязательно отображает информацию о статусе домена, например, для зоны .ru в случае снятия с делегирования прописан state: REGISTERED, UNDELEGATED . Статусы доменных имен вы можете посмотреть в нашем .

Причины для срочного снятия домена с делегирования разнятся. Инициатива может исходить как от владельца домена, так и от регистратора. Если сам владелец желает мгновенно отключить от домена все связанные с ним сервисы и сайты, ему нужно установить для домена статус UNDELEGATED (в зависимости от доменной зоны статусы могут варьироваться), и задача будет выполнена. Если к регистратору поступает жалоба на определенный домен, он вправе снять домен с делегирования принудительно на свое усмотрение.

Кроме экстренных случаев снятия домена с делегирования существуют также стандартные, регламентированные правилами реестра.

Делегирование и период регистрации домена

После окончания срока регистрации домена домен снимается с делегирования и наступает период блокировки, по прошествии которого домен удаляется из Реестра. Домены в зонах .ru , .su и .рф не удаляются по выходным и праздничным дням, а также в первый рабочий день после нерабочего дня. Для большинства западных доменных зон установлены похожие правила.

Делегирование домена занимает некоторое время

Из-за технических особенностей системы преобразования доменных имен (т.н. система DNS) после установки для домена DNS-серверов домен проделегируется на них не сразу. Несмотря на то, что почти в тот же момент информация на whois-сервере изменится, локальные DNS-серверы интернет-провайдеров получат ее только через некоторое время. Опытным путем установлено, что на делегирование домена, т.е. на распространение информации о новых DNS среди интернет-провайдеров нашей планеты, требуется около 24 часов . Но не стоит удивляться, если после смены DNS-серверов Вы сможете увидеть работоспособный сайт на вашем домене намного раньше. Однако может случиться и так, что сайт будет недоступен по прошествии суток. Максимальный промежуток времени, требуемый на делегирование домена, — 72 часа .

Делегирование доменов

Delegate (англ) - уполномочивать; передавать полномочия. Необходимым условием для использования доменного имени в сети Интернет является делегирование домена. Работоспособность делегированного домена обеспечивается серверами DNS домена - программно-аппаратными комплексами, содержащими необходимую информацию о домене и предоставляющими ее в соответствии с техническими требованиями сети Интернет. Обеспечение наличия не менее двух серверов DNS делегируемого домена, имеющих надежное подключение и круглосуточно функционирующих, является обязанностью Администратора.

Чтобы проверить , делегирован ли домен, Вы можете воспользоваться Whois -сервисов R01.
У делегированного домена домена присутствует строка вида:
status: REGISTERED, DELEGATED

Чтобы делегировать домен необходимо:
- авторизоваться в .
- зайти в раздел "Домены" и щелкнуть, как по ссылке, по имени домена, который Вы хотите делегировать.
- в меню "Инструменты" выбрать "Редактирование" и следовать пошаговой инструкции. На первом же шаге Вам будет предложено ввести список DNS-серверов с которыми Вы хотите делегировать домен.
- после постановки задания в очередь на выполнение, Вы можете отслеживать его состояние в разделе "Очередь заданий" .

Обращаем Ваше внимание, что так как информация в мировой системе DNS распространяется не мгновенно, то Ваш домен будет доступен из сети интернет в течении 6-8 часов после делегирования.

Какие проверки производятся при делегировании?

Перед делегированием домена проверяются следующие пункты:
1) Указанные DNS-серверы являются авторитативными для домена.
2) На них присутствуют SOA- и NS-записи
3) Список NS-записей совпадает со списком DNS-серверов.

Вы можете самостоятельно проверить корректность настройки DNS-серверов при помощи команды nslookup.

Что делать, если при делегировании возникла ошибка?

".. не удается получить SOA-запись.." , то для устранения указанной ошибки Вам необходимо обратиться в компанию, предоставляющую Вам DNS-сервера с просьбой завести зону для Вашего домена.
Если по какой-либо причине это невозможно, для делегирования домена Вы можете воспользоваться DNS-серверами Регистратора.

Если при делегировании возникла ошибка "..не совпадает список DNS-серверов.." , то в форме ввода DNS-серверов при изменении информации по домену в личном кабинете, Вам необходимо указывать ровно тот список DNS-серверов которые прописаны в ns-записях Вашей зоны на DNS-серверах с которыми Вы делегируете Ваш домен.

Если при делегировании возникла ошибка "не удается найти ip-адрес для DNS-сервера ns.test.ru" , то Убедитесь что на DNS-серверах с которыми делегирован домен test.ru есть A-запись для ns.test.ru. Если соответствующая запись есть, то напишите письмо в нашу службу поддержки с описанием проблемы.
Проверить, с какими DNS-серверами делегирован test.ru, можно в Whois. Опросить DNS-сервер можно с помощью команды nslookup

Если при делегировании возникла ошибка "Вы не можете использовать CNAME ns1.example.com для сервера имен" , то либо необходимо внести А-записть для ns1.example.com, либо использовать другие DNS-сервера при делегировании домена.
Ошибка возникает, т.к. Использование имен DNS-серверов, которые являются CNAME-записями, крайне не рекомендуется стандартом RFC1912, так как подобные записи могут привести к некорректной работе делегированного домена. Это увеличивает размер DNS-траффика, в некоторых случаях приводит к циклическим запросам. Подробнее о данной проблеме Вы можете прочитать здесь (пункт 2.4): ftp://ftp.rfc-editor.org/in-notes/rfc1912.txt

Домен делегирован, но сайт с этим именем не открывается. Что делать?

Убедитесь, что на DNS-серверах с которыми делегирован домен test.ru есть A-запись для test.ru. Проверить с какими DNS-серверами делегирован test.ru можно в whois . Опросить DNS-сервер можно с помощью команды nslookup. Если соответствующая А-запись есть, то возможно изменения были произведены слишком недавно и информация не успела распространиться до используемого Вашим локальным компьютером DNS-сервера. В этом случае имеет смысл подождать когда информация распространиться автоматически (обычно в пределах суток)

Возможно ли делегировать домен не на имена, а на ip-адреса DNS-серверов?

Нет, при делегировании домена необходимо указывать имена DNS-серверов.
Но если Вам необходимо делегировать домен test.ru с DNS-серверами, имеющими имена в зоне test.ru, то список DNS-серверов необходимо указывать в таком виде:
ns1.test.ru 192.168.15.86
ns2.test.ru 192.168.15.87

Многие начинающие владельцы сайтов интересуются, почему домен доступен не сразу. Действительно, ведь регистрация занимает всего несколько минут, на что уходит остальное время? Такая же проблема возникает во время переноса адреса на другой хостинг. Виной тому является Из статьи вы узнаете, что это такое.

Перед тем как начать регистрацию, необходимо выбрать название будущего сайта, которое должно состоять из уникальной последовательности букв или цифр (допускается использование дефиса, но не в конце или начале). Эта комбинация - доменное имя вашего ресурса. Приобрести свободный адрес вы можете у компаний-регистраторов, которые легко можно найти.

Процесс регистрации

Первым делом вы заходите на ресурс, который предоставляет нужные вам услуги. Заполняете анкету, в которой указываете свои данные. Регистратор инспектирует их и, если все правильно, вносит запись о новом адресе в специальный реестр, то есть проводит делегирование доменов. Вскоре информация обновляется на главных серверах. В случае если это необходимо, обновляется кэш на DNS-серверах.

Каждый этап регистрации занимает определенное количество времени, которое зависит от настроек организации. Именно поэтому вы не можете начать пользоваться ресурсом сразу после оплаты адреса. Проверить делегирование домена можно в панели управления в вашем личном кабинете на сайте регистратора.

Перенос домена

Существует такая процедура, как или его переделегирование. Чтобы ее осуществить, вам необходимо подать заявку на смену перечня NS-серверов. Сделать это можно в личном кабинете на сайте регистратора. Для корректной процедуры вам нужно указать новые адреса серверов, на которые и будет производиться переделегирование.

Изменения вносятся быстро, примерное время - около получаса. Затем начинается более длительный процесс (вплоть до нескольких суток) - на серверах провайдеров закэшировалась неактуальная информация о старых значениях.

Такое обновление зоны домена - процесс, которым невозможно управлять. Время ожидания зависит от настроек предыдущих серверов и состояния DNS каждого отдельно взятого провайдера. Технически невозможно предсказать, когда он кончится и делегирование доменов будет завершено. Именно поэтому следует запастись терпением и не обвинять новый хостинг в нерасторопности: в этом случае от него практически ничего не зависит.

Что нужно сделать, чтобы ускорить процесс?

Основная причина, замедляющая делегирование доменов - кэширование неправильной информации о них. Если вы регистрируете совершенно новый адрес, просто проявите немного терпения и подождите, этот процесс не должен занять много времени. Имеет смысл действовать, если вы переносите домен, тогда сократить время ожидания вполне возможно.

  • Свяжитесь с администратором сервера, на который делегируется адрес, и попросите его изменить информацию TTL (выставить минимальное значение).
  • Протестируйте зону домена. Многие компании-регистраторы предлагают сделать это автоматически. Иногда из-за проблем в сети эта процедура завершается ошибкой даже при правильно сконфигурированной зоне, поэтому вы сами должны решить, пользоваться ли этим советом.
  • При изменении списка серверов для домена не обращайтесь к нему какое-то время. Если вам нужно провести работу с ресурсом во время переноса, обратитесь к хостинг-провайдеру. Спросите про служебное доменное имядля обращения к ресурсам (называются также техническими псевдонимами).
  • Если вы можете сделать это, очистите кэш резолвера самостоятельно. К примеру, в операционной системе Windows вы можете это сделать с помощью консольной команды.

Подводим итоги

Итак, теперь вы знаете, что значит делегирование домена. Это второй этап регистрации вашего адреса в сети Интернет. Сначала добавляется информация о новом адресе в специальную базу данных, затем домен непосредственно делегируется. Без выполнения этих важных этапов можно не ожидать от ресурса работы.

Делегирование - важный этап регистрации. Только после того как он будет полностью пройден, адрес станет полностью работоспособным, и только тогда вы сможете увидеть сайт во Всемирной паутине. Иными словами, делегирование - активация зарегистрированного домена.